MagicLite panels are lightweight, steel reinforced autoclave aerated concrete wall panels. Ideal for both external and internal non loadbearing wall, these panels are best suited to today’s design challenges for increased energy efficiency, fire safety, sound transmission, insulatingproperties as well as increased earthquake safety.

Fire-resistant properties and non-combustible (4 hours for 100 mm)

Toxic-free and can achieve energy savings to tune of 30%

4 times faster construction as compared to traditional masonry

Thermal efficiencies reduce energy costs by eliminating the original reliance on cooling and heating appliances.

Better option to use thinner internal walls (75 mm or 90 mm) instead of 100 mm and as a result there is an increase in floor space area between 1 - 2 %.

Weigh 1/4th of bricks and 1/5th of standard concrete. Savings on structural steel

1. Clean and Mark the wall alignment. Clean the floor and ceiling without dust or dirt

before making the line by the chalk tape.

2. Clean MagicLite AAC Wall Panel and move to the marked point.

3. Mix thin-bed mortar and apply it on structure. Apply mix thin bed mortar on column structure

for increase adhesion between the MagicLite AAC wall panel and the structure.

4. Lift the wall panel and push it to attach the column.

5. Insert a filler between beam and top of the wall panel.

6. Use lever to lift MagicLite wall panel until top of the panel reach the upper floor

then insert a wood wedge under the panel.

7. Use GI L-clamp to fasten the panel with floors on both upper and lower side of the

panel by using fasteners

8. Apply thin-bed mortar on side of the first panel then lift the next wall panel to attach

and do the same as the previous steps.

9. Continue install wall panels until the gap can be closed by the last panel.

10. Insert Backer Rod in the gap between beam / top slab and top of Wall Panel.

11. Fill the gap if any between beam / top slab and top of Wall Panel by PU Foam and

remove the excess of it.

12. Fill the gap under the panels and in between the panels with sand-cement mortar

and allow it to dry.

13. Finishing all gaps again with skim coat then rub with sandpaper #200.

14. Finish MagicLite AAC wall panel installation. Can finish the surface with painting or as required.

Common FAQ’s ?

Seepage Issues?The cellular structures of our

AAC Wall Panel are comprised of

many independent, closed, tiny and

dispersed air spaces. Such a unique

structure enables our panel to

effectively prevent water from

penetrating through it.

Cracks?Cracks are created mainly because

of drying shrinkage, quality of

workmanship, height and use of high

ratio of cement mortar. Such

problems are avoided because of

using reinforced AAC Wall Panels

Space Saving?AAC Wall Panels offers excellent

water barrier & insulation properties,

giving better option to use thinner

internal walls (75 mm or 90 mm)

instead of 100 mm and as a result

there is an increase in floor space

area between 1 - 2 %.

Is it reliable?The system is highly reliable and

is being commonly used in countries

like China, Australia, Thailand and

across various South Asian Countries.

Load Capacity?

AAC have good load bearing

capacity, the static hanging weight

in a single point is around 120 Kgs

Chasing and Nailing?Both chasing and nailing can be

done in similar way as in AAC Blocks

Productivity?

Faster than brick 4 times and easily

installed by groove and tongue

panels impact to labor capacity

more than 9.71 sq.m./man/day
